For the Best Actress in a Leading Role, Marion Cotillard (Two Days, One Night), Rosamund Pike (Gone Girl), Falicity Jones (The Theory of Everything), Reese Witherspon (Wild) and Julianne Moore (Still Alice). They all are outstandingly talented women. Let the best win!
Now, for the Best Actress in a Supporting Role, Patricia Arquette (Boyhood), Emma Stona (Birdman), Laura Dern (Wild) Meryl Streep (Into The Woods) and Keira Knightley (The Imitation Game). It will be the talented and expert Meryl Streep the winner? Let’s wait and find out.
Now, the men. For the Best Actor in a Leading Role, the nominates are Steve Carrel (Foxcatcher), Michael Keaton (Birdman), Bradley Cooper (American Sniper), Eddie Redmayne (The Theory of Everything) and Benedict Cumberbatch (The Imitation Game).
The candidates for the Best Actor in a Supporting Role are: Robert Duvall (The Judge), Mark Ruffalo (Foxcatcher), Ethan Hawke (Boyhood), J.K. Simmons (Whiplash) and Edward Norton (Birdman).
At last but nos least, are you anxious to know who are the nominees for the most important category? So am I. So, for The Best Picture, American Sniper, The Imitation Game, Birdman, Selma, Boyhood, The Theory of Everything, The Grand Budapest Hotel and Whiplast.
